How Bitcoin is Shaping the Future of Other Cryptocurrencies

Bitcoin, the pioneer of cryptocurrencies, has not only revolutionized digital finance but also laid the foundation for the development of countless other cryptocurrencies. Since its inception in 2009, Bitcoin’s decentralized model and blockchain technology have inspired innovation, competition, and adaptation across the crypto ecosystem. This article explores the multifaceted ways Bitcoin influences the growth and evolution of other cryptocurrencies, from technological advancements to market dynamics and regulatory impacts.

Technological Advancements Driven by Bitcoin

Bitcoin introduced the world to blockchain technology, a decentralized ledger system that ensures transparency and security. While Bitcoin’s blockchain remains a benchmark, newer cryptocurrencies have built upon or diverged from its design to address limitations such as scalability, speed, and energy efficiency.

One of the most significant innovations inspired by Bitcoin is the development of alternative consensus mechanisms. Bitcoin relies on Proof of Work (PoW), a secure but energy-intensive process. To overcome this, cryptocurrencies like Ethereum transitioned to Proof of Stake (PoS), which reduces energy consumption and improves scalability. Other platforms, such as EOS, use Delegated Proof of Stake (DPoS) to further enhance transaction speeds and efficiency.

Smart contracts, introduced by Ethereum, represent another leap forward. These self-executing contracts enable decentralized applications (dApps), a feature Bitcoin’s original design lacks. Platforms like Binance Smart Chain and Solana have since adopted and refined smart contract functionality, expanding the use cases for blockchain technology beyond simple transactions.

Market Dynamics and Bitcoin’s Dominance

Bitcoin’s market performance often sets the tone for the entire cryptocurrency sector. As the most widely recognized and traded digital asset, Bitcoin’s price movements tend to influence the valuation of other cryptocurrencies, commonly referred to as altcoins. When Bitcoin’s price surges, it often creates a bullish trend across the market, driving up demand for altcoins. Conversely, a Bitcoin downturn can trigger a broader market correction.

The competitive landscape has also spurred innovation. Cryptocurrencies like Solana and Polkadot have emerged with unique selling points, such as faster transaction speeds and improved interoperability, to differentiate themselves from Bitcoin. This competition pushes developers to continuously enhance their platforms, benefiting the overall ecosystem.

Regulatory Influence and Compliance

Bitcoin’s prominence has made it a focal point for regulators worldwide. As governments and financial institutions grapple with how to oversee cryptocurrencies, Bitcoin’s regulatory treatment often sets precedents for other digital assets.

In jurisdictions with clearer regulations, such as the U.S., guidelines from bodies like the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) have provided a framework for new cryptocurrency projects. For instance, the SEC’s approach to token offerings has influenced how altcoins structure their initial coin offerings (ICOs) or security token offerings (STOs) to ensure compliance.

However, regulatory uncertainty remains a challenge. Stricter policies in some regions could stifle innovation, while favorable regulations could encourage adoption. Bitcoin’s ability to navigate these complexities has made it a model for other cryptocurrencies seeking mainstream acceptance.
